 The $80 No Limit Hold'em ($4,000 GTD) has a price point that seems to be very popular with players, and offers an impressive return on investment (for those going deep in the tournament).  Last night's installment saw registration close with (73) entries, and after the optional add-ons were included in the prize pool, the official number closed at $5,255.  A total of ten players were scheduled to reach the money, with action playing down to an outright winner.  Andrew Kern outlasted the field, taking home $1,786 for first place, along with 24.81 leaderboard points (which puts him atop the Player of the Month leaderboard).  Official results from the tournament are listed below, along with an updated leaderboard:
  1. Andrew Kern (Ft. Lauderdale, FL) $1,786
  2. Erik Horbeek (Ft. Lauderdale, FL) $1,025
  3. Pieter Hogoboom (Ft. Lauderdale, FL) $641
  4. Jason Puzacke (Fort Pierce, FL) $434
  5. Martin Borras (Sunny Isles, FL) $328
  6. Jose Pulido (Miami Beach, FL) $263
  7. Danilo Parada (Oakland Park, FL) $231
  8. Andrew Blake (Boynton Beach, FL) $210
  9. Roberto Alvarado (Pompano Beach, FL) $179
  10. Melanie Hochman (Boynton Beach, FL) $158



Tournaments: Saturday's 6:00pm tournament is one of the most popular on the schedule, as it offers an incredibly affordable buy-in, that always sees some great returns.  The $130 No Limit Hold'em ($5,000 GTD) event has consistently crushing the posted guarantee, as the prize pool reaches five-figures on a weekly basis.  

The tournament is structured with starting stacks of 15,000 chips, and levels that last (20) minutes throughout the event. Registration is open through Level 8, allowing for almost three hours of play, prior to the window closing for the night.

Promotions: From 9:00am (the minute the doors open) until 11:00pm, $300 high hands will be awarded every (30) minutes. These high hands must be aces-full or better, use both hole cards, and be the winning hand (in a pot that has at least $10).  From 11:00pm until close, $100 high hands will be awarded every (30) minutes.

In addition to the high hands, there is a "bonus" promotion in place, which offers $1,000 to the highest hand from the 9:00am-12:00pm time period.  If a player makes a straight flush in the 9:00am-9:30am qualifying period, and that is the best qualifying high hand from 9:00am-12:00pm, they will earn an extra $1,000 (in addition to the $300 they were awarded for the half-hour time period).
